JOHN BOOTH: One Hundred Thirty-Fifth in a Series of Jess Williams Westerns (Short Story)

Rate this book
Jess is on the hunt for another ruthless killer when he gets a wire from a county sheriff in the town of Goudy. The message says that his old friend, John Booth, is locked up in his jail for killing a man without having a warrant on him to prove he was wanted.

Jess drops everything and immediately heads to Goudy to get Booth out of jail. He informs the sheriff that the man Booth killed was indeed wanted dead or alive by the law.

After getting Booth released into his custody as a Deputy United States Marshal, Jess takes him along on the hunt for two more killers, agreeing to split the bounty money with him to help him get back on his feet…again.

About the author

Robert J. Thomas

193 books61 followers
Librarian's note: There is more than one author in the Goodreads database with this name.

In 1990 Robert J. Thomas was sworn in as the full time mayor for the city of Westland, Michigan. He served twelve years, making him the longest serving mayor in Westland's history.

While he was mayor he wrote his first book titled, How to Run for Local Office, which has now sold over 25,000 copies worldwide.

He has written and published on Kindle, the Jess Williams Westerns series. Retired, he now lives in Mississippi with his wfe Jill.
